Forum Discussion
insert12_38638
Nimbostratus
May 14, 2016HTTP Monitor
Hi, I am trying to configure an HTTP monitor with following send and receive string but this monitor mark my pool as down
Send string = GET /xyz.abc.dyx.ezt.co.uk/alive HTTP/1.1\r\n
Receive= al...
Vijay_E
Cirrus
Jul 01, 2016Try this:
GET /alive HTTP/1.1\r\nHost: xyz.abc.dyx.ezt.co.uk\r\nConnection: Close\r\n\r\n
If it doesn't work, you can use this CURL command to check the output from bash on the F5:
curl -H "Host: xyz.abc.dyx.ezt.co.uk" http://x.x.x.x/alive
You can also use the following from bash for troubleshooting http monitor:
echo -e "GET /alive HTTP/1.1\r\nHost: xyz.abc.dyx.ezt.co.uk\r\nConnection: Close\r\n\r\n" | nc x.x.x.x 80
x.x.x.x is the IP of the pool member
Since you are running 11.6, you may be able to troubleshoot better using /var/log/monitors:
Look under "monitor logging" - https://support.f5.com/kb/en-us/solutions/public/12000/500/sol12531.html
Help guide the future of your DevCentral Community!
What tools do you use to collaborate? (1min - anonymous)Recent Discussions
Related Content
DevCentral Quicklinks
* Getting Started on DevCentral
* Community Guidelines
* Community Terms of Use / EULA
* Community Ranking Explained
* Community Resources
* Contact the DevCentral Team
* Update MFA on account.f5.com
Discover DevCentral Connects